The UK's Largest Customer Review Website for the Property Industry
3.9/5, 12 Reviews75% Recommended
0% letting valuation accuracy
75% letting fee satisfaction
By submitting this form, you agree to allAgents Ltd sending these details to Peter Woods (London) Ltd
Copyright © 2006 - 2025 allAgents.co.uk - All rights reserved.